The Health Protection (Coronavirus Restrictions and Functions of Local Authorities) (Amendment) (Wales) Regulations 2020 Minutes: The Business Committee agreed to set a reporting
deadline of Monday 14 December for the Legislation, Justice and
Constitution Committee to report on the regulations. |
|
Update on Legislative Consent Memorandums Minutes: Business
Committee agreed to refer the SLCM on the Medicines and Medical Devices Bill to
the Health and Social Care Committee and LJC Committee with a reporting
deadline of 11 January 2021 and the SLCM on the Environment Bill to the Climate
Change, Environment and Rural Affairs Committee and LJC Committees with a
reporting deadline of 4 February 2021. Business
Committee also agreed not to refer the SLCM on the Internal Market Bill to a
committee. |
